Income Tax (Trading and Other Income) Act 2005 section 479
Exclusion of pension policies
Section 479 excludes insurance policies connected with registered pension schemes from the rules in this chapter on taxation of gains from life insurance policies.
Example
ABC Ltd operates a registered pension scheme for its employees. As part of the scheme's investment arrangements, the pension trustees hold several insurance policies. Because these policies are held in connection with a registered pension scheme, they are excluded from the life insurance gains rules under section 479. Any growth in value of those policies is not subject to income tax under this chapter. Instead, the policies fall within the pension tax regime and are taxed accordingly under the rules for registered pension schemes.
